Position Summary

Our Nestlé Development Center (NDC) in St. Joseph, MO is home to dogs and cats who help us learn, research, and better understand the well-being of pets and promote the human animal bond. When you join us, you'll work to ensure our pets have the best quality of care while participating in cutting edge pet food research. Research that contributes to innovative, first to market dietary solutions as well as trusted all life stage pet food. Our center is located near the metropolitan area of Kansas City, within 30 minutes of the Kansas City International airport. St. Joseph is a tight-knit, rural community packed with character, still within commuting distance to the city thus, providing many residential opportunities.

As an Associate Technician, Animal Care, you’ll be responsible for organizing and performing the necessary work related to the care, palatability, or nutritional testing of the pets under general supervision.

  • Knowledge of and compliance with the Animal Welfare Act and the Nestlé Purina R&D Petcare Manual
  • Adherence to Nestlé Quality Management Systems (QMS) and Good Laboratory Practices (GLP)
  • Accurately and reliably record data as outlined by the requesting project scientists.
  • Collect and process samples for standard and non-standard nutrition tests.
  • Obtain animal body weights and Body Condition Scoring (BCS)
  • Provide care including daily feedings of the pets and basic grooming
  • Report to the veterinary staff sick or unusual behavior observed in the pets

Requirements

  • High School Diploma (or GED)
  • 2+ years of professional animal handling/husbandry and/or regular care of animals
